A Callan-Symanzik study of the lambdapsi34 + gpsi36 theory
Description
A Lsub(I) = lambdapsi34 + gpsi36 theory is investigated using Callan-Symanzik equations. Logarithmic corrections to trivial fixed-point behaviour are obtained. The theory is shown to correspond to a model for tri-critical phenomena in 3He-4He mixtures. (Auth.)
